Abstract

The application provides a shield tunneling machine for tunnel collapse rescue and a use method thereof. The shield tunneling machine is sequentially assembled by a cutter head, a front shell, a rear shell and a shield tail, and a residue discharging system is further arranged in the shield tunneling machine to outwardly convey the excavated earth and rocks in the tunneling process. A cutter head assembly of the cutter head is partially detachable, and a rescue channel for the human body to pass through is formed at the cutter head by detaching the partially detachable structure. A cutter head driving motor is located in the front shell and is in transmission connection with the cutter head to drive the cutter head to rotate around an axis. A main drive is arranged on the inner side of the tail end of the rear shell. A deviation correction drive is arranged between the front shell and the rear shell in the shield tunneling machine. The shield tunneling machine solves the problem of unreasonable design and inconvenient use of the existing shield system for tunnel collapse rescue.

[0001] This invention relates to the field of tunnel collapse rescue, and in particular to a tunnel boring machine and its method of use for tunnel collapse rescue. Background Technology

[0002] During tunnel construction, tunnel boring machines (TBMs) are widely used in tunnel excavation, especially in emergencies such as collapses, where they provide crucial support for rescue efforts. When a tunnel collapses or other safety incidents occur, it is essential to quickly remove debris or accumulated soil to create a safe working space and passage for rescue personnel. Therefore, designing a TBM suitable for tunnel collapse rescue is of great significance for improving tunnel rescue efficiency and ensuring personnel safety.

[0003] Existing tunnel boring machines (TBMs) are mainly used for tunnel excavation in tunnel construction. However, in the event of a tunnel collapse, traditional TBMs do not have the ability to efficiently clear the collapsed material and open up rescue channels. Therefore, a TBM that can quickly establish rescue channels and support rescue operations after a tunnel collapse is needed. Summary of the Invention

[0052] See Figures 1 to 13 This embodiment provides a tunnel boring machine (TBM) for tunnel collapse rescue, which is assembled sequentially from a cutterhead 1, a front shell 2, a rear shell 3, and a tail shield 4. The entire machine is made of high-strength steel. The TBM also includes a muck removal system 5 to transport the excavated soil and rock outwards during the tunneling process. The specific structure is as follows:

[0053] The cutter head 1 includes a cutter head assembly 11 and a hopper. The hopper includes an annular hopper shell 12 and a drive connecting ring 13. The cutter head assembly 11 is fixedly installed at the front end of the annular hopper shell 12, and the drive connecting ring 13 is fixedly installed at the rear end of the annular hopper shell 12. The drive connecting ring 13 is connected to the cutter head drive motor 21 in the front housing 2 so as to drive the cutter head 1 to rotate around the axial direction through the cutter head drive motor 21. The inner wall of the annular hopper shell 12 is also fixed with guide plates 14 distributed circumferentially to guide the soil and rock entering the annular hopper shell 12 onto the belt conveyor 51 that extends into the annular hopper shell 12 through the middle of the drive connecting ring 13. The shape of the guide plates 14 can be adjusted according to design needs and space.

[0054] The blade assembly 11 includes a main blade fixing plate 111, a secondary blade fixing bracket 112, and a rear fixing ring 113. Two main blade fixing plates 111 are arranged parallel to each other at the center of the blade disc 1 and fixed to the rear fixing ring 113. Two sets of secondary blade fixing brackets 112 are respectively arranged on the outer side of the two main blade fixing plates 111 and between the rear fixing ring 113. The secondary blade fixing bracket 112 on one side is detachably connected to the corresponding main blade fixing plate 111. A roller cutter 114 and a cutting blade 115 are distributed and installed between the two main blade fixing plates 111 and on the secondary blade fixing brackets 112. Because the secondary blade fixing bracket 112 on one side is detachably connected to the corresponding main blade fixing plate 111, the secondary blade fixing bracket 112 can be detached to form a rescue passage for human passage at the blade disc 1.

[0055] In another embodiment, the auxiliary cutter head fixing brackets 112 on both sides are detachably connected to the corresponding main cutter head fixing plates 111.

[0056] Since the area where trapped personnel are usually located is relatively large after a tunnel collapse, they can usually find and avoid the danger zone in time. Therefore, there is generally no need to worry about the secondary cutter head fixing frame 112 injuring people when it falls directly. However, it is necessary to avoid the secondary cutter head fixing frame 112 rolling when it falls directly, as well as collision damage to the secondary cutter head fixing frame 112 and other parts of the tunnel boring machine. To this end, the design of the chain and lifting lugs can minimize or reduce this problem: the inner wall of the annular hopper shell 12 or the front end face of the drive connecting ring 13 is also fixed with lifting lugs for suspending the chain. Before the secondary cutter head fixing frame 112 is disassembled, it is connected by the chain. After removing the connecting bolts and removing the secondary cutter head fixing frame 112 outward, the secondary cutter head fixing frame 112 is slowly lowered by controlling the chain to prevent the secondary cutter head fixing frame 112 from falling freely to the ground.

[0057] In this embodiment, the secondary cutter head fixing bracket 112 on one side is fixed to the corresponding main cutter head fixing plate 111 by a threaded connection (12 M30 bolts), while the secondary cutter head fixing bracket 112 on the other side is a welded integral structure with the corresponding main cutter head fixing plate 111.

[0058] During disassembly:

[0059] Connect the lifting lugs on the secondary cutter head fixing bracket to the two Φ12 chains;

[0060] Use an electric wrench to remove the fixing bolts one by one;

[0061] The auxiliary cutter head fixing frame is slowly lowered using an electric hoist to prevent free fall;

[0062] After removal, a rescue channel with a diameter of approximately 0.8 to 1.0 meters is formed in the center of the cutterhead.

[0063] A further preferred structure is as follows: the secondary cutter head fixing bracket 112 on one side includes a base connecting plate 1121, an inclined plate 1122, and a horizontal plate 1123. The base connecting plate 1121 is arranged along the length direction of the corresponding main cutter head fixing plate 111, and the base connecting plate 1121 is attached and fixed to the outer surface of the corresponding main cutter head fixing plate 111 by a threaded connection. The two horizontal plates 1123 are parallel to each other and one end is fixed to the middle of the base connecting plate 1121, and there is a set distance between the two horizontal plates 1123 to install the roller cutter 114 and the cutter 115. The two inclined plates 1122 are parallel to each other and one end is fixed to the outside of the base connecting plate 1121, the horizontal plate 1123, or the main cutter head fixing plate 111, and there is a set distance between the two inclined plates 1122 to install the roller cutter 114.

[0073] The main drive is the jacking cylinder 8, which is circumferentially distributed in the rear housing 3. A segment mounting ring 9 is also provided at the rear end of the rear housing 3. The main body of the jacking cylinder 8 is arranged along the axial direction of the tunnel boring machine, and the two ends of the jacking cylinder 8 are respectively hinged with hinged connection parts 7. The hinged connection part 7 at the front end of the jacking cylinder 8 is fitted and fixed to the inner wall of the rear housing 3, and the hinged connection part 7 at the rear end of the jacking cylinder 8 is fixedly connected to the segment mounting ring 9. The distance between the segment mounting ring 9 and the tail shield 4 is adjusted by driving the jacking cylinder 8, so that the segment 10 is installed between the two.

[0074] The working principle of the hydraulic cylinder is as follows: When the hydraulic cylinder retracts, the rear housing 3 moves forward, and the distance between the rear housing 3 and the tail shield 4 increases to form a segment installation area. The segment 10 is installed between the two. After the installation is completed, the jacking hydraulic cylinder 8 is driven to extend, the segment installation ring 9 tightens the segment 10 and pushes the shield machine forward as a whole.

[0075] The correction drive is a correction cylinder 6, which is circumferentially distributed between the front housing 2 and the rear housing 3. The two ends of the correction cylinder 6 are respectively hinged to the hinge connection parts 7 fixed on the inner walls of the front housing 2 and the rear housing 3. It is used to fine adjust the attitude of the tunnel boring machine and adjust the extension and retraction of the cylinder according to the real-time attitude data of the tunnel boring machine to ensure the stable operation of the tunnel boring machine.

[0076] The rear housing 3 has openings distributed along its circumference. A reaction force bracket 31 is installed and fixed inside the rear housing 3 at the corresponding opening. An electrically controlled telescopic reaction force system 32 is installed on the reaction force bracket 31. The telescopic end of the reaction force system 32 is directly opposite the opening and can extend to the outside of the rear housing 3 through the opening. The reaction force system 32 is an electric push rod or a hydraulic cylinder.

[0077] The stabilizing effect of the reaction force system: The reaction force system 32 is embedded in the soil around the tunnel boring machine through a telescopic structure to improve the stability of the tunnel boring machine, prevent unstable vibrations or instability during tunneling or rescue, and also ensure the smooth advancement of the tunnel boring machine during operation.

[0078] The tail section 4 includes a bottom rail 41 and a segment support ring 42 erected at one end of the bottom rail 41. The main structure of the tunnel boring machine is supported by the bottom rail 41 in the initial state. A support 43 for supporting the segment support ring 42 is fixed on the back. The support 43 is fixedly connected to the bottom rail 41 or is an integral structure. The end of the bottom rail 41 where the support 43 is located is also connected to an extension rail for the electric muck removal vehicle 52 to move outward to the designated position for muck removal.

[0079] The slag removal system 5 includes a belt conveyor 51 and an electric slag removal vehicle 52. The main body of the drive connecting ring 13 is also a ring structure. One end of the belt conveyor 51 extends through the ring structure of the drive connecting ring 13 to the tail end of the cutter head assembly 11 to receive the slag brought into the tunnel boring machine after the cutter head assembly 11 cuts. A reversible lifting system 53 is installed at the bottom of the belt conveyor 51. The electric slag removal vehicle 52 travels between the slag discharge end of the belt conveyor 51 and the slag removal area outside the tunnel boring machine. Most existing tunnel boring machines are not used for tunnel rescue, so the slag removal system does not consider issues such as dismantling / removal. In this embodiment, the belt conveyor 51 is designed as a reversible and lifting mechanism to avoid the conveyor blocking the passage after the rescue passage is dug. The conveyor belt width is 400mm-600mm, the speed is 1.2 m / s, and it can operate continuously.

[0080] The specific operating method of this tunnel boring machine is as follows:

[0081] Drilling mode: During tunnel collapse rescue, the shield machine is first positioned, the cutterhead 1 is started, and the collapsed body is excavated by the rotation of the cutterhead 1. Then, the main drive and the tail of the shield 4 are used to install the tunnel segments 10 and push the shield machine forward as a whole. The slag removal system 5 discharges the slag that has been cut into the shield machine. The correction drive makes small corrections based on the shield machine's attitude data. The tail of the shield 4 is used to install the tunnel segments 10 according to each ring of the shield machine's excavation.

[0082] Rescue mode: After the shield tunnel rescue channel is opened, the cutter head is stopped and the drive is stopped. The tailings are cleared, the electric muck truck 52 is moved out, and the belt conveyor 51 is moved back and lowered to an appropriate position or completely removed, so as not to affect the passage of rescue personnel. Then, at the cutter head assembly 11 inside the shield machine, a rescue channel that can be passed through the human body is formed at the cutter head 1 by disassembling the aforementioned detachable structure. Rescue personnel enter the area where the trapped personnel are located and rescue the trapped personnel through the rescue channel. After the rescue is completed, the secondary cutter head assembly is reinstalled.
